Hello,

the Realdrums have a very nice live character that I would not want to do without if possible.

Unfortunately, I cannot turn down various drum instruments such as crash cymbals, sometimes the kick or the snare in the presets. This is because there are only a small number of Realdrums where you can export individual stems of drum instruments in order to edit and mix them separately in the DAW.

Although I have reduced the volume of the drum instruments in question by -10, -20 or even by minus 40%, saved this and restarted Band in a Box, I cannot hear any noticeable difference in the volume...

What could be the reason for this? Can you turn down individual drum instruments in the settings mentioned?

Originally Posted by Mike HP.
I've since learned that the thing about reducing the volume only applies to MIDI-Drums, not to Realdrums.
Yup, that's correct. Most Realdrums are mixed down to a stereo mix, meaning that individual drum volumes cannot be changed.

Happy to help! And yeah, I use Nova on nearly all of my projects in one way or another.

I also noticed you mentioned other plugins like Toontrack etc - since you likely have a number of drum plugins there's another route you could go. All of the RealDrums in BIAB are live recordings done with acoustic drum kits, but when recording them we also set up MIDI triggers - this MIDI data is used in BIAB as notation, however it can be exported in a MIDI file which you could then import into your DAW and use whatever drum plugin you want. This wouldn't be quite as "live" sounding as using the RealDrums directly, but depending on the plugin you use it would allow you to adjust the mix as desired, swap out different drum and cymbal sounds, change the groove, etc.

In the main BB app exporting MIDI can be done in a couple different ways - here's a tutorial vid:


In the plugin, it's as simple as dragging and dropping the "Chart" button into the DAW (once the tracks are generated).
